Good team/people to work with, great boss, poor hotel management - Avis employé Valet Attendant Chatham Bars Inn

Avantages

The bell team itself is a great group to work with. Probably the most family-like team you’ll find on property. You make friends and the pay is solid with tips included. Miladin and Max are great at the head of the team and, overall, you’ll share some laughs and good times. Good opportunity to network with guests as well, many of whom are successful in their own fields and other valets have landed jobs from connections they’ve made at CBI.

Inconvénients

The rest of the hotel management is incredibly disorganized and out to lunch. Decisions contradict one another and lack common sense. There’s a reason they seem to be churning out managers in other departments and higher up in the company left and right. This can be frustrating considering the Bell/Valet team is consistently rated by evaluators as the best department and yet other departments often create messes for the bell team to rectify. Sometimes can be a bit overstaffed and the employee meals are terrible (plus they’re served during the busiest times for valet so it’s difficult to find time to grab dinner). Also, there’s basically no upward mobility within the hotel so it’s a summer job or a long-time waiting for any sort of promotion to anything else.
